Output 68bd93a4ab53813a1ad00321e77406aac6eba4b9394992b181c355348c48a12d:1

value
400000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12a212fc9ea48dcd75d1824970c856b778d7bda8 OP_EQUALVERIFY OP_CHECKSIG
address
12hXKZgdDcAZEknQQWnCXH4eQNFm1TvYpw
transaction
68bd93a4ab53813a1ad00321e77406aac6eba4b9394992b181c355348c48a12d
spent
true